Bought My 99 Tahoe Used and I was Told that the
Trans was rebuilt not to long before i bought it
I Gave the Tahoe to My Daughter to drive and she has had no complaints with it,I Drove it to a Job I have in the Mountains about 50 Miles away, Drove Great up to the Jobsite and on the way back I Got into town and it started to shift really hard just
when i got back into town Did it about three times
(May i add that the weather was very Cool and it was raining) well I got home and Lifted the Hood and
it Smelled Hot and Like Hot Trans Fluid,I Checked underneath and i couldn't find any leaks!
any Suggestions? I Checked Fluid and it Looked Full with engine Running! Should i add Something like LUCAS additive for Hard Shifting?
